BREAKING: Fulani herdsmen abduct 2 varsity students in Taraba

The FrontierThe FrontierApril 2, 2024 3140 Minutes read0

•Fulani herdsmen

Two students of the Federal University Wukari, Taraba state were last night abducted in Wukari by suspected Fulani herdsmen.

The institution’s Chief Security Officer, Sule Gani, confirmed the incident today, reports The Nation.

He said the victims graduated but stayed behind to remedy some of their courses.

According to him, the incident occurred around 11 pm around the school premises.

Gani said: “They carried him and one lady. They are spill-over students. He came out to buy something and some suspected Fulani herdsmen took them away.”

Efforts to reach the Taraba police spokesman failed. He was yet to pick calls to his mobile as of press time.
